首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从数组中删除mongoDB

从数组中删除MongoDB是指在MongoDB数据库中删除数组中的元素。MongoDB是一种开源的文档数据库,它使用类似于JSON的BSON格式来存储数据。在MongoDB中,可以使用$pull操作符来删除数组中的元素。

$pull操作符可以接受一个查询条件,用于指定要删除的元素。以下是一个示例:

代码语言:txt
复制
db.collection.update(
   { <query> },
   { $pull: { <field>: <value> } }
)

其中,collection是要操作的集合名称,query是查询条件,field是要删除元素的字段名,value是要删除的元素的值。

以下是对该问题的完善答案:

概念:从数组中删除MongoDB是指在MongoDB数据库中删除数组中的元素。

分类:这个操作属于MongoDB数据库的数据操作。

优势:使用MongoDB进行数组删除操作具有以下优势:

  1. 灵活性:MongoDB支持动态模式,可以轻松地处理不同结构的数据,包括数组。
  2. 强大的查询功能:MongoDB提供了丰富的查询操作符,可以灵活地查询和删除数组中的元素。
  3. 高性能:MongoDB使用索引和内存映射文件等技术来提高查询和删除操作的性能。

应用场景:从数组中删除MongoDB的操作在以下场景中非常有用:

  1. 社交网络应用中,用户可能有多个好友,需要从好友列表中删除某个好友。
  2. 电子商务应用中,用户可能有多个收藏商品,需要从收藏列表中删除某个商品。
  3. 博客应用中,文章可能有多个标签,需要从标签列表中删除某个标签。

推荐的腾讯云相关产品:腾讯云提供了多个与MongoDB相关的产品,包括云数据库MongoDB、云函数、云服务器等。以下是其中一个产品的介绍链接地址:

  • 云数据库MongoDB:腾讯云提供的一种高性能、可扩展的NoSQL数据库服务,支持自动扩容、备份恢复等功能,适用于各种规模的应用场景。

请注意,本答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以符合要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

17分23秒

09.尚硅谷_MongoDB入门_删除文档.avi

8分33秒

22-删除数组元素

3分8秒

099_尚硅谷_Scala_集合(二)_数组(二)_可变数组(四)_删除元素

26分41秒

141_尚硅谷_以太坊项目二_去中心化eBay_MongoDB简介(中)

7分9秒

MySQL教程-47-删除表中的数据

13分19秒

day07_数组/19-尚硅谷-Java语言基础-数组中的常见异常

13分19秒

day07_数组/19-尚硅谷-Java语言基础-数组中的常见异常

13分19秒

day07_数组/19-尚硅谷-Java语言基础-数组中的常见异常

5分16秒

【剑指Offer】18.2 删除链表中重复的结点

7.5K
6分30秒

【剑指Offer】3. 数组中重复的数字

24.3K
5分43秒

从零玩转Git-版本控制工具 13 删除分支 学习猿地

11分28秒

Java零基础-253-往byte数组中读

领券